Unlock Binomial Success: Likelihood Explained Simply!

in expert
14 minutes on read

The binomial distribution, a cornerstone of statistical analysis, provides a powerful framework for understanding discrete probability. Calculating likelihood is essential for unlocking the true potential of the binomial model. The concept of likelihood for binomial distribution allows data scientists at organizations like Stanford University to determine the parameters that best explain observed outcomes, crucial for applications using tools like R programming. Understanding this is vital for analysts like Abraham de Moivre (in spirit of his great work), whose contributions to probability theory underpin modern statistical methods.

Unveiling Binomial Likelihood: Your Key to Statistical Insights

Imagine you're running an A/B test on your website. You show version A to 100 visitors and version B to another 100. Version A results in 15 conversions, while version B yields 20. Which version is truly better? Is the difference significant, or just due to random chance? Answering these questions requires understanding the statistical underpinnings of such tests.

The Binomial Distribution is a cornerstone of statistical analysis, perfectly suited for scenarios like this where we're counting the number of successes (e.g., conversions) in a fixed number of independent trials (e.g., website visits). It provides a framework for understanding the probability of observing a specific number of successes given a certain underlying probability of success.

The Power of the Binomial Distribution

The binomial distribution allows us to model scenarios with two possible outcomes: success or failure.

Consider flipping a coin, marketing campaign conversion rates, or the proportion of defective items in a manufacturing process. These scenarios all share a common thread. They can be elegantly described by the binomial distribution.

However, to truly unlock the insights hidden within our data, we need more than just the binomial distribution itself. We need to understand the likelihood of different parameter values given the data we've observed.

Demystifying the Likelihood Function

This is where the Likelihood Function enters the picture.

This article aims to demystify the concept of the likelihood function, specifically for the binomial distribution. We will explain what it is, how it differs from probability, and how it helps us to estimate the most likely values for the parameters that govern the binomial distribution. We will focus on clarity and accessibility, making this powerful statistical tool understandable for everyone, regardless of their mathematical background.

Decoding the Binomial Distribution: Foundations for Likelihood

Before we dive into the intricacies of the likelihood function, it's crucial to establish a firm understanding of the Binomial Distribution itself. This distribution serves as the bedrock upon which the likelihood function is built, and grasping its core principles is essential for interpreting the results we obtain later.

Defining the Binomial Distribution

At its heart, the Binomial Distribution models the number of successes observed in a fixed number of independent trials. Each of these trials is known as a Bernoulli Trial, characterized by having only two possible outcomes: success or failure. Think of flipping a coin multiple times. Each flip is a Bernoulli Trial, and the entire sequence of flips follows a Binomial Distribution.

The key here is independence. One trial doesn't influence the outcome of another. This assumption is critical for the Binomial Distribution to be applicable.

Unpacking the Parameters: n and p

The Binomial Distribution is defined by two key parameters: n and p. Understanding these parameters is paramount.

  • 'n': The Number of Trials. This parameter represents the total number of independent trials conducted. For example, if you flip a coin 10 times, then 'n' would be 10. This value is always a positive integer.

  • 'p': The Probability of Success. This parameter denotes the probability of success on a single trial. In the coin flip example, assuming a fair coin, the probability of getting heads (our defined "success") is 0.5, so 'p' would be 0.5. The value of p always falls between 0 and 1, inclusive.

These two parameters, n and p, completely define the Binomial Distribution for a given scenario. By specifying these values, we can calculate the probability of observing any number of successes.

The Probability Mass Function (PMF): A Brief Encounter

The Probability Mass Function (PMF) provides the probability of observing a specific number of successes (let's call it k) given the parameters n and p. The PMF is expressed mathematically as:

P(X = k) = (n choose k) pk (1 - p)(n - k)

Where "(n choose k)" represents the binomial coefficient, calculating the number of ways to choose k successes from n trials.

The PMF gives us the probability of seeing a particular outcome, while the Likelihood Function answers a slightly different question. We'll delve into this distinction later. The PMF focuses on probability; the Likelihood Function focuses on the plausibility of the parameters (n, p) given the data we have observed. While mathematically related, their interpretation is fundamentally different. It’s the key to unlocking the power of statistical inference.

Likelihood Function Unmasked: Probability vs. Likelihood

Having established the foundation of the Binomial Distribution, we can now delve into the concept of the Likelihood Function. This function represents a crucial shift in perspective, moving from calculating probabilities of outcomes to assessing the plausibility of parameters given observed data.

Understanding the Likelihood Function

The likelihood function, unlike the Probability Mass Function (PMF), reverses the roles of parameters and data. In the PMF, we fix the parameters (n and p) and calculate the probability of observing a specific number of successes. With the likelihood function, we fix the observed data (the number of successes) and treat the parameters (n and p) as variables.

In essence, the likelihood function tells us how likely it is that different parameter values could have generated the data we observed. It quantifies the compatibility between the assumed model (Binomial Distribution) and the actual data.

Probability vs. Likelihood: A Critical Distinction

It's vital to understand the fundamental difference between probability and likelihood.

  • Probability addresses the question: "Given that we know the parameters of the distribution, how likely is it to observe this particular outcome?" It's a forward-looking calculation.

  • Likelihood, on the other hand, asks: "Given that we have observed this particular outcome, how plausible are different values for the parameters of the distribution?" It's a backward-looking inference.

Probability deals with the chances of different outcomes, while likelihood concerns the plausibility of different parameter values. This difference is subtle but profound and is central to many statistical inference techniques.

The Mathematical Representation

The likelihood function for the binomial distribution is directly derived from the PMF. If we observe 'k' successes in 'n' trials, the likelihood function, denoted as L(p; n, k), is given by:

L(p; n, k) = nCk pk (1 - p)(n - k)

Where:

  • L(p; n, k) is the likelihood of the parameter 'p' given 'n' trials and 'k' successes.
  • nCk is the binomial coefficient, representing the number of ways to choose 'k' successes from 'n' trials. It is calculated as n! / (k! * (n-k)!).
  • p is the probability of success on a single trial (the parameter we're trying to estimate).
  • k is the number of successes observed in the 'n' trials (the fixed data).
  • n is the number of trials (also fixed data).

Notice how 'n' and 'k' are treated as fixed, while 'p' is the variable we are exploring. The goal is to find the value of 'p' that maximizes this function, indicating the most plausible value for the success probability given the data we observed.

Maximum Likelihood Estimation (MLE): Finding the "Most Likely" Parameters

Having established the crucial distinction between probability and likelihood, we now turn to how we can actually use the likelihood function to make inferences about the unknown parameter p. This is where Maximum Likelihood Estimation (MLE) comes into play. MLE is a powerful and widely used method for estimating the parameters of a statistical model. In the context of the binomial distribution, MLE allows us to find the value of p that best explains the observed data.

Unveiling Maximum Likelihood Estimation

At its core, Maximum Likelihood Estimation (MLE) is a technique for determining the parameter values that maximize the likelihood function. In simpler terms, we seek the value of p that makes the observed data the "most likely" to have occurred.

Imagine you've flipped a coin 10 times and observed 7 heads. What is your best guess for the probability of the coin landing on heads? MLE provides a systematic way to answer this question. We would evaluate the likelihood function for various values of p (the probability of heads) and select the value of p that yields the highest likelihood. This p is our maximum likelihood estimate.

The Intuition Behind MLE

The underlying intuition behind MLE is quite straightforward: The best estimate for a parameter is the one that makes the observed data the most plausible. We're essentially finding the "sweet spot" in the parameter space where the model aligns best with the empirical evidence.

The MLE doesn't guarantee that the estimated parameter value is the true value. However, it provides the most likely value given the assumptions of our model and the data we've observed.

The Log-Likelihood Trick

In practice, instead of directly maximizing the likelihood function, we often maximize the log-likelihood function. This is because the logarithm is a monotonically increasing function. Maximizing the log-likelihood is equivalent to maximizing the likelihood.

So, why use the log-likelihood?

There are two primary reasons:

  • Computational Simplification: The likelihood function often involves products of probabilities. Taking the logarithm transforms these products into sums, which are computationally easier to handle.
  • Mathematical Convenience: Differentiation is often used to find the maximum of a function. It is typically easier to differentiate a sum than a product, making the log-likelihood more amenable to analytical or numerical optimization.

The log-likelihood for the binomial distribution will have a different formula than the likelihood function itself, but it will follow directly from applying the logarithm. This transformation makes the optimization problem significantly more tractable, allowing us to efficiently find the maximum likelihood estimate for p.

Real-World Likelihood: Applications and Practical Examples

The pursuit of the "most likely" parameters, as facilitated by Maximum Likelihood Estimation (MLE), transcends theoretical exercises and finds profound resonance in numerous real-world applications. The binomial distribution, coupled with the power of likelihood, becomes an indispensable tool for data-driven decision-making across diverse fields.

Diverse Applications of Binomial Likelihood

The binomial distribution and its associated likelihood function have broad applicability. Consider these examples:

  • A/B Testing: In marketing and web development, A/B testing aims to determine which version of a webpage or advertisement performs better. The binomial distribution models the number of conversions (successes) out of the total number of users exposed to each version. Likelihood analysis then helps to estimate the conversion rate (p) for each version and determine if the difference is statistically significant.

  • Quality Control: Manufacturing processes often involve inspecting a sample of products to assess the overall quality. The binomial distribution can model the number of defective items in a sample. By calculating the likelihood of observing a certain number of defects, manufacturers can estimate the defect rate (p) and decide whether to adjust the production process.

  • Election Polling: Political polls aim to predict the outcome of elections. The binomial distribution can model the number of voters who support a particular candidate in a sample. Likelihood analysis can estimate the candidate's support level (p) in the entire population, along with confidence intervals that reflect the uncertainty inherent in the sampling process.

A Detailed Example: Conversion Rate Optimization

Let's consider a practical example of A/B testing on a website. Suppose we are testing two versions of a landing page: Version A (the control) and Version B (the treatment). We expose 1000 users to each version and observe the following results:

  • Version A: 50 conversions (5% conversion rate)
  • Version B: 70 conversions (7% conversion rate)

The question is, is the 2% increase in conversion rate for Version B statistically significant, or could it be due to random chance?

Calculating the Likelihood

We can calculate the likelihood of observing these results for different values of 'p' (the conversion rate). For Version A, the likelihood function is proportional to:

L(p | data) ∝ p50

**(1-p)950

Similarly, for Version B:

L(p | data) ∝ p70** (1-p)930

We can evaluate these likelihood functions for a range of 'p' values to see which value maximizes the likelihood.

Automating the Process with Python

The code below demonstrates how to calculate and visualize the likelihood function using Python:

import numpy as np import matplotlib.pyplot as plt from scipy.stats import binom # Data nA, xA = 1000, 50 # Version A: 1000 trials, 50 successes nB, xB = 1000, 70 # Version B: 1000 trials, 70 successes # Range of p values to evaluate p_values = np.linspace(0, 0.1, 100)

Calculate likelihoods

likelihood_A = binom.pmf(xA, nA, pvalues) likelihoodB = binom.pmf(xB, nB, p_values)

Plotting

plt.figure(figsize=(10, 6)) plt.plot(p_values, likelihoodA, label='Version A Likelihood') plt.plot(pvalues, likelihood_B, label='Version B Likelihood') plt.xlabel('Conversion Rate (p)') plt.ylabel('Likelihood') plt.title('Likelihood Function for A/B Testing') plt.legend() plt.grid(True) plt.show()

This code calculates the likelihood for a range of possible conversion rates and plots the results. The peak of each curve represents the Maximum Likelihood Estimate (MLE) for 'p'.

Interpreting the Likelihood Curve

The likelihood curve provides valuable insights:

  • MLE: The peak of the curve indicates the MLE for the conversion rate. In our example, the peak for Version A is around 0.05 (5%), and the peak for Version B is around 0.07 (7%). These are our best estimates for the true conversion rates based on the observed data.

  • Uncertainty: The shape of the curve reflects the uncertainty in our estimate. A wider, flatter curve indicates greater uncertainty, while a narrower, sharper curve indicates more confidence in our estimate. The relative heights of the curves at various 'p' values tell us how much more likely one value of 'p' is compared to another.

  • Comparison: By comparing the likelihood curves for Version A and Version B, we can visually assess the evidence for the superiority of Version B. If the curve for Version B is consistently higher than the curve for Version A across a range of 'p' values, this provides evidence that Version B is indeed better. More rigorous statistical tests, such as likelihood ratio tests, can be used to formally assess the statistical significance of the difference.

In conclusion, the binomial distribution and the likelihood function provide a powerful framework for analyzing data and making informed decisions in a variety of real-world applications. By understanding how to calculate and interpret likelihood, we can extract valuable insights from data and optimize our strategies.

Defining Success and Failure in the Binomial Context

While the binomial distribution elegantly models scenarios with binary outcomes, it's crucial to understand that the terms "success" and "failure" within this framework don't always align with conventional, positive or negative connotations. Instead, they represent predefined and mutually exclusive outcomes that we are interested in measuring.

Beyond Positive and Negative

The binomial distribution, at its core, is concerned with counting the number of times a specific event occurs within a fixed number of trials.

Therefore, the event we choose to count is labeled "success," irrespective of its inherent desirability.

Conversely, any outcome other than the defined "success" is classified as a "failure."

This labeling is purely for the purpose of mathematical modeling and analysis, not a value judgment on the outcome itself.

Examples Across Diverse Scenarios

Consider these examples that underscore the context-dependent nature of success and failure:

Quality Control: Defect as Success

In a quality control process, a "success" might represent a defective product identified during inspection.

While a manufacturer certainly doesn't desire defective products, the binomial distribution allows them to model the probability of encountering such defects in a batch.

The "failure" here would be a non-defective product.

Medical Testing: Positive Result as Success

In medical testing for a disease, a "success" could represent a positive test result, indicating the presence of the condition.

Again, this doesn't imply that a positive test result is inherently desirable, but rather that it is the outcome being measured within the binomial model.

A "failure" would then be a negative test result.

Marketing: Conversion as Success

In marketing, a common application is tracking conversions or sales following an advertising campaign.

Here, a "success" would refer to the event where a potential customer makes a purchase.

This is the outcome the company is tracking, and so naturally this falls under the definition of a success.

The "failure" would be any other action than a purchase, or no action at all.

The Importance of Clear Definition

The critical takeaway is that clearly defining what constitutes a "success" and a "failure" is paramount before applying the binomial distribution. This definition drives the interpretation of the results and ensures that the model accurately reflects the underlying phenomenon being studied. Failing to properly define the parameters would only result in skewed results.

FAQs: Understanding Binomial Likelihood

[This section answers common questions about the likelihood calculations in binomial distributions. We aim to clarify any confusion and provide quick, helpful information.]

What exactly is "likelihood" in the context of a binomial distribution?

Likelihood, in this case, represents the probability of observing a specific sequence of successes and failures given a particular probability of success (p) within a set number of trials. It's a measure of how plausible a specific value of 'p' is, given the data we've observed.

How does likelihood differ from probability in the binomial setting?

While both relate to chances, likelihood focuses on the probability of the parameters (like 'p' in a binomial distribution) given the observed data. Probability, on the other hand, usually calculates the chance of observing specific data given known parameters. They are, therefore, inverse questions.

What affects the likelihood calculation for a binomial distribution?

The key factors are the number of trials, the number of successes observed, and the hypothesized probability of success on a single trial (p). Changing any of these will alter the likelihood value. Higher likelihood values indicate a better fit between the hypothesized 'p' and the observed data.

Why is maximizing the likelihood important when working with binomial data?

Maximizing the likelihood allows us to find the most plausible value for the probability of success ('p') given the observed data. This "maximum likelihood estimate" is valuable for making predictions and inferences about the binomial process. It provides the "best" estimate of 'p' based on your sample.

So there you have it – a clearer view on likelihood for binomial distribution! Hopefully, you're feeling more confident now. Go forth and use these concepts to make great inferences! Good luck, and have fun!